Willard Fuller Obituary

Dr. Willard Fuller, Th.D. Dr. Willard Fuller, Th.D., went home to God April 8, 2009. Born in Louisiana in l915, Dr. Fuller began his theological studies in the 1940s. He became a Baptist minister in the early 1950s. Achieving a doctorate degree in theology, he founded a world-wide ministry, Lively Stones World Healing Fellowship, in California in 1968. He traveled the world extensively spreading the Gospel and the truth of God's word, praying for the sick, teaching and conducting numerous healing seminars. He loved people considering it an honor and privilege, in the love of Christ, to listen to the concerns of all those who came to him for comfort, counsel, and prayer. Dr. Fuller's ministry will be carried on by Althea Cook-Fuller, Fellowship president.
